Book series status

Volume 4 is going to be rather like volume two, a number of story threads and adventures. Blar, Tsika, and Glycerin have to work their threesome life. Glycerin continues her evolution as a dual personality. The band has a record to cut. There's an East European tour adventure - we are introduced to a new character Nadia who takes the roller coaster ride in new directions. Sashiko and Hank provide their own twists ... the turns and twists of life while trying to "Go Big" as a band.

If you're unfamiliar with my story ... think of it as a "K-ON for grownups" but with a plot that progresses, romance, comedy, drama.
Glycerin here is the British six foot lead guitarist of the band. She suffers from several mental conditions but copes with life with the help of her best friend, a petite Russian Goth bass guitarist named Tsika. The two belong to an all female band called The Lost Girls, they are near bankruptcy when a new person joins the band with a bit of funding and connections from his previous band. And it's a guy.

Dark comedy and twisted romance follow, "It Really IS Rocket Science".
